Как выбрать разработчика для создания мобильного приложения для iOS и Android под ключ?

Дата публикации: 15 ноября 2024 года
Как не потерять миллионы на разработке мобильного приложения для iPhone и Андроид? Почему Портфолио и Отзывы - это недостаточный аргумент при выборе исполнителя? Сегодня я расскажу о неочевидных тонкостях при выборе разработчика.
Привет, это Антон Картунов, основатель и директор компании White Tiger Soft.
Почти 15 лет мы выводим бизнесы на новый уровень с помощью мобильных приложений.
У нас за плечами более 100 проектов для малого, среднего и крупного бизнеса.
И мы как никто знаем, как сложно сделать выбор среди огромного количества на первый взгляд одинаковых компаний и их предложений.
Итак, на чем же стоит заострить внимание?

Ваши бизнес-цели слышат?

Подрядчики должны ставить в приоритет бизнес-цели клиента, а не хотеть просто побыстрее сделать проект и получить деньги.

Какова ваша цель?
  • Запуск стартапа и привлечение инвестиций
  • Снизить расходы
  • Увеличить доходы
  • Автоматизировать процессы

Но если у вас пока нет четкой цели, то можно потратить впустую много ресурсов: времени, бюджета, энергии команды.
Есть хорошее выражение:
Стоять на 50% эффективнее, чем двигаться в противоположную сторону от цели!

Как понять, что подрядчику важны бизнес цели?

Если с вами пообщались, засыпали вопросами о содержании и логике приложения, все ваши ответы были собраны и структурированы - скорее всего, такие специалисты доведут вас до нужного результата.

Ваше приложение будет удобно вашим клиентам?

Приложение пишется для конечного пользователя, а не для Заказчика - это суровая истина. То есть приложение должно быть удобным, полезным и нравится тем, кто будет скачивать приложение и пользоваться им.

Как понять, что компания это понимает?

  • Спросите, как команда будет проектировать UI/UX (интерфейс и пользовательский опыт)
  • Спросите, как обеспечивается удобство использования приложения?
  • И обязательно спросите про неудачный опыт: вы в том числе платите за умение команды предвидеть. Чем больше успешно разрешённых проблем за плечами разработчика, тем он компетентнее.

Вам дают гарантии?

Если в договоре нет речи про гарантии или гарантия слишком маленькая - менее 6 месяцев, то вам стоит задуматься.

Разработка занимает какое-то время, зачастую, не один месяц. И только потом выпускается в свет. Серьёзная компания-разработчик должна дать вам длительную гарантию на продукт: после релиза много пользователей устанавливают приложение и могут возникают ошибки или непредвиденные ситуации.

Это нормальная ситуация. Ошибки будут возникать. И разработчики по гарантии могут ее исправить. Если продукт, над которым долго трудилась целая команда выдерживает без поддержки только пару месяцев (то есть на срок небольшой гарантии) - это должно насторожить.

Поэтому запомним:
  • гарантия только 1-3 месяца - это мало
  • хорошая гарантия - 6 месяцев
  • ещё лучше - 12.

Достоверность кейсов или портфолио

Первым делом клиент идет смотреть портфолио разработчика. Достоверность портфолио очень сложно проверить, как и работу с именитыми компаниями. Разработчики могут ссылаться на NDA, и говорить лишь о факте сотрудничества со знаменитой компанией, не раскрывая детали.

Как проверить кейсы и портфолио?

  • Запросите контакты предыдущих клиентов. Хотя бы несколько. Если компании нечего скрывать, то она даст эти контакты. Если контакты не дают вовсе - это настораживает.
  • Либо, посмотрите портфолио компании на Rating Runeta. Там сами рейтинги проводят ежегодные жесткие процедуры подтверждения реальности заявляемых кейсов и удаляет компании из рейтингов в случае, если кейсы не будут подтверждены. Поэтому на этой площадке портфолио сложно манипулировать.

А как насчёт рейтингов?

Если есть чем гордиться, компании не упустят возможность поделиться своими заслугами и результатами.

Сейчас активно развивается “Рейтинг Рунета”. Как с его помощью можно подстраховать себя и узнать больше о компании в которую вы собираетесь обратиться?

  • Обращайте внимание на позиции: компания в широком или узком рейтинге?
  • Например, быть 1 по России и быть первым в родном маленьком городе - это разные результаты. Лучше, если компания заняла топовое место среди "Разработчиков для малого бизнеса", чем среди "Разработчиков приложений классической музыки 2 половины ХХ века" - утрирую, чтобы было понятнее, как объективно оценивать места в рейтингах.
  • Быть Топ-30 в широких рейтингах - хороший результат.

И в целом, если компания есть в ретинге, это уже хорошо: чтобы туда попасть, нужно пройти серьезную проверку. Так что вошедшая в рейтинг компания:
  1. точно реальна, это не номинальное ЮР.лицо
  2. компания ежегодно предоставляет отчёт об оборотах, справки из банка
  3. компания проходит ежегодную проверку подлинности кейсов и клиентов из портфолио (возвращаясь к предыдущему пункту)

К слову, в этом году мы вошли в ТОП-20 разработчиков приложений России и заняли 2 место в рейтинге среди лучших разработчиков приложений для бизнеса. И по себе можем сказать, что это стоило больших многолетних усилий.

А теперь внимательно изучите КП и смету

Обращаясь в разные компании, вы получите разную стоимость. Почему? Причины разнообразны.

Будьте внимательны к деталям: что есть в смете? Стоимость на что вам озвучили? Запросите подробную смету с детализацией каждой функции: цены должны идти не крупными мазками, а складываться из трудозатрат на реализацию функций, экранов, интеграций, страниц и так далее.

Вам должны прислать подробный расчёт (обычно, это Excel таблица) помимо красивой презентации и упрощенной сметы. Иначе есть риск, что необходимых функций попросту не будет в приложении.

Некоторые компании хитрят, присылая расчёт MVP - той версии приложения, где всего будет по минимуму. Так делается специально, чтобы привлечь клиента низкой ценой. Исключение: если вы сами не запрашивали именно MVP.

Но при финальном подписании договора на разработку 1) или стоимость вырастет в разы, 2) или вам и вправду разработают мини-продукт, которые не решит поставленных перед ним целей.

Тогда помимо материального вопроса, встает и этический вопрос. Вам нужно будет сотрудничать с людьми, которые используют манипуляции и пренебрегают принципом прозрачности. Вы правда подписываетесь на многомесячную или многолетнюю работу с ними? По-моему, плохая идея.

Кто будет делать ваш проект?

Надо убедиться, что специалистов в команде достаточно:
  • Дизайнер
  • Аналитик
  • Мобильные разработчики
  • Серверные разработчики
  • Менеджер проекта
  • Тестировщик
  • Старший специалист или руководитель в каждом отделе
Если нет руководителя отдела, некому проверить результат работы специалиста. Это значит, что в конечном итоге проверять будет Заказчик. А наличие руководителя:
  • Это гарантия качественного результата
  • Это обширные практический большой опыт, значит сохранение денег клиента на ошибках (за который в основном и платит заказчик)
  • Серьезное внутреннее качество продукта
  • Без этого - за "внутренние" недостатки в итоге будет расплачиваться клиент, просто не сейчас - а в будущем
  • Качественный проект проще и дешевле обслуживать и развивать

Как проверить состав команды?

Просто задайте вопрос, какие специалисты работают на проекте, если раздела "Команда" нет на сайте.

Вот зеленые флажки:
  • Если есть руководители отделов или старшие специалисты, значит, каждый член команды, как и команда в целом даст лучший результат.
  • Если к проекту подключаются директор на какой-либо стадии, например, технический директор, арт директор, операционный или исполнительный директор, это хороший признак (руководству не все равно на проекты).
  • Узнайте, возможен ли Zoom хотя бы с частью команды для знакомства.
Все работают в офисе? Или удаленно? Почему это важно:
  • Удаленных сотрудников сложнее контролировать.
  • Удаленные сотрудники обычно работают в рамках "задач", которые им назначены, и сильно меньше заинтересованы в результатах работы над проектом в целом.
  • Задачи в плотной коммуникации в офисе решаются быстрее и качественнее. Поэтому легче соблюдать сроки.
  • Не возникнут ситуации, когда кто-то из команды разработчика внезапно не выходит на связь, и из-за этого проект остановился.

Подведем итоги

Теперь вы знаете, как правильно выбрать разработчика или подрядчика для создания мобильного приложения на iOS и Android для смартфонов, телефонов или планшетов.

Если у вас мало опыта в IT-сфере, наилучшим решением станет обратиться к специалистам компании White Tiger Soft, которые помогут написать ваш IT продукт. Мы оперативно подготовим расчет стоимости и подробно опишем каждый этап создания проекта, чтобы у вас была полная прозрачность относительно всех расходов. Мы придерживаемся принципа открытого сотрудничества, поэтому у вас всегда будет полная и достоверная информация по ходу подготовки и реализации проекта.
Вопросы и ответы
Автор статьи
Генеральный директор
Вам понравилась статья?
Читайте также